Default 2002 Neon - Gauges stopped working, no interior light

Hi All,

I did do a search for this problem, but did not find all that i need...

we have an '02 Neon and last night the dash went blank, no gauges, no lights, no interior light.

I checked all of the fuses in the dash and under the hood and all are good. I did the cluster reset and no results at all .

I have read that there was a common issue with solder joints coming loose. but cannot find a current link to the procedure to fixing this.

Default dask is working now

went outside a minute ago and for giggles, took the key and noticed that when i opened the door, the trip meter was lit and when i put the key in the ignition, the chiming started.. pushed in the trip button and turned the key to run and the dash came alive and all gauges went through their tests. also noticed that the interior light is working.

could this be a heat issue?? the gauges went dead when the car was being driven... I tried to diagnose it when it was still warm... this morning, it is about 6 degrees C.. and it lit up no problem...
